GREEK STYLE KABOBS WITH PITA BREAD | |
Kabobs: 1 lb. pork tenderloin (see note at bottom) 8 pieces of pita bread 1-2 onions, sliced thin 1-2 tomatoes, sliced thin salt pepper oregano olive oil 1-2 lemons Tzatziki Sauce (optional) fresh parsley, chopped (optional) wooden skewers Cut pork into bite size pieces. Season with lemon juice, salt, pepper, oregano and olive oil. Skewer meat and cook on the grill. Brush pita bread with a bit of oil and grill as well. When the meat is tender, put 1 skewer on each pita and slowly draw out the skewer leaving the pieces of meat in the pita. Add the onion, tomato, parsley and sauce. Roll the pita. A piece of grease-proof or wax paper can be rolled along the bottom half of the pita for a less messy sandwich. Boneless country style ribs may be substituted for the pork tenderloin, but requires a few hours in a marinade of olive oil, lemon juice, pepper and oregano. Just add salt before grilling. Tzatziki Sauce: 1 lb. yogurt, preferably greek or whole milk 2 tbsp. extra virgin olive oil 1 tbsp. red wine vinegar 10 shakes of salt 5 shakes of pepper 2-3 large pieces of garlic, crushed (to your taste) 1 very large cucumber, peeled and grated Squeeze excess water from cucumber and mix with remaining ingredients. May be refrigerated for up to one week. |
